Seat Leon

SEAT is entering a new era: The new Leon is a simply stunning car - with its unique, emotional design, with its dynamic sporting character, with its compelling package of innovative technologies and with its refined quality and premium elegance.

The third generation of the SEAT Leon is an all-new car developed from the ground up. Its predecessors stood for driving fun and outstanding functionality - a tradition that the new SEAT Leon will most certainly continue. Like its predecessor, the new SEAT Leon is also built at the Martorell factory near Barcelona in Spain. Since the premiere of the first-generation Leon in 1999, SEAT has sold 1.2 million vehicles from this highly successful range.

The new SEAT Leon is a strong and emotional personality - it is the most beautiful way to drive a functional car. The five-door is packed full of high-end technologies - in its infotainment, its assistance systems, its running gear and its drive. The engines combine effortless performance with exemplary efficiency.

Every single power unit, all of them state-of-the-art TDI and TSI engines, are the best in their class in fuel consumption and emissions. The highlight is the Leon 1.6 TDI with start/stop system - its average fuel consumption is just 3.8 litres per 100 kilometres, equating to 99 grams of CO2 per kilometre.

At 4.24 metres, the new SEAT Leon is around five centimetres shorter than its predecessor, yet the wheelbase has grown by almost six centimetres. This improves its overall proportions and posture on the road, allowing short overhangs as well as enhancing the car's stance on its wheels. Despite its shorter length, its clever packaging means that interior space - both in the cabin and in the trunk are improved.

The second-row seats and luggage compartment

In the rear of the new SEAT Leon, too, shoulder, knee and head room are extremely generous. The comfortable rear bench is equipped with three head restraints. In the interests of the very youngest passengers, standard equipment includes Isofix and Top Tether anchors for child seats. Thanks to systematic lightweight design, the rear bench back rest is approximately 15 percent lighter than in the previous model - without any sacrifice in comfort.

The luggage compartment of the new SEAT Leon has a capacity of 380 litres, which is exactly 39 litres more than in the previous model.

The rear bench back rest is extremely straightforward to fold forward - and comes with a 60:40 split as of the Reference line. Once folded forward, the load floor is almost completely flat and measures 1,558 millimetres in length.

The Bodyshell - lightweight and solid

Its low kerb weight is one of the great strength of the new SEAT Leon; compared with the preceding model, it is down by 90 kilograms. In its base version, the new Leon weighs just 1,113 kilograms.

High-strength and ultra-high-strength steels

A bodyshell that offers optimum safety and the best possible comfort has to be solid. An intelligent structure guarantees that the vehicle remains lightweight and efficient. Lightweight solidity - SEAT set itself this challenge and equipped the new Leon with an utterly state-of-the-art body-in-white. With an eye on optimum value for money, costly materials like magnesium and carbon fibre were avoided - instead, the bodyshell features a high proportion of high-strength and ultra-high-strength steels. The hot-formed hi-tech steels alone reduce weight by 18 kilograms, while ensuring increased passenger cell stiffness.

The excellent bodyshell stiffness lays the groundwork for the high production quality, for the precise handling and for the quiet passenger cabin, virtually undisturbed by unpleasant frequencies. Thanks to careful insulation, the interior of the new SEAT Leon is as quiet as that of a car from the next class up. Its aerodynamic refinements include the underbody cladding and the airflow through the engine bay.

In total, the body-in-white of the new Leon is lighter by 25 kilograms. Systematic lightweight design extends across every one of the vehicle's sub-assemblies - many parts in the engines, running gear and interior also contribute to weight reduction.

The Drive - powerful and efficient

SEAT sends the new Leon into battle with powerful and fuel-efficient TDI and TSI power units ranging from 1.2 to 2.0 litres displacement. All engines feature direct injection with turbocharging and have been optimised for low internal friction and rapid warm-up. Sporty power and ground-breaking efficiency are what set the new engine generation in the SEAT Leon apart. Compared with their respective predecessors, fuel consumption is down by up to 22 percent.

For the first time, all engines offered at market launch are available with a start/stop system - the 1.6 TDI with 77 kW (105 PS), the 2.0 TDI with 110 kW (150 PS) and the 1.4 TSI with both 90 kW (122 PS) and 103kW (140PS).

Start/stop and recuperation system

All the engines in the new SEAT Leon use the latest efficiency technologies. The start/stop system deactivates the engine when the car is at a standstill with the gearstick in neutral and the clutch disengaged. On re-engaging gear, a more powerful starter motor restarts the engine - quietly, smoothly and quickly. The start/stop system, which can be deactivated by the driver at any time, also works perfectly with the DSG transmission. Thanks to a very powerful battery with an excellent cycle life, the system remains active even under extremely cold winter conditions. The start/stop system saves up to four percent of fuel per 100 kilometres.

The recuperation system, a further efficiency measure in the new SEAT Leon, uses intelligent voltage regulation in the alternator to recover energy under braking and trailing throttle conditions. This is temporarily stored in the battery, flowing back into the vehicle electric system when the car subsequently accelerates. This takes the load off the alternator by enabling it to run from time-to-time on a lower voltage or to be switched off entirely. It draws less power from the engine, resulting in lower fuel consumption.

The transmission

When it comes to transferring power to the wheels, the transmissions on offer vary in accordance with the engine and range from a five or six-speed manual to the compact and lightweight dual-clutch gearbox. It changes its six or seven gears in a matter of milliseconds and is incredibly efficient. Certain variants come with a freewheeling function, which reduces real-life fuel consumption even further.

The TDI engines

The 1.6 TDI available at market launch with 77 kW (105 PS) generates 250 Nm of torque from a displacement of 1,598 cm3. In the version with the start/stop and recuperation system, it consumes just 3.8 litres of diesel per 100 kilometres in the NEDC, which equates to 99 grams of CO2 per kilometre.

The 2.0 TDI equipped with the start/stop consumes an average of just 4.1 litres of fuel per 100 kilometres. With 110 kW (150 PS) and 320 Nm of torque, the TDI engine with a displacement of 1,968 cm3 provides the new SEAT Leon with ample propulsion.

In early 2013, the diesel range will be further enhanced by the 1.6 TDI with 66 kW (90 PS) and 230 Nm of torque. It will consume 4.1 litres per 100 kilometres and emit 108 grams of CO2 per kilometre. The highlight of the TDI range will be a 2.0-litre unit, producing 184PS and 380Nm, that will join the range later in 2013.

The TSI engines

The TSI engines in the new SEAT Leon start with the 1.4 TSI. The modern, turbocharged power unit features direct injection and produces 90 kW (122 PS) and 200 Nm of torque. The engine is equipped as standard with the start/stop and recuperation system and consumes just 5.2 litres of Super petrol per 100 kilometres, equating to 120 grams of CO2 per kilometre.

Early 2013 sees the arrival of the 1.2 TSI in two versions with 63 kW (86 PS) and 77 kW (105 PS).

Also in early 2013, a 1.4 TSI with an output of 103 kW (140 PS) and torque of 250Nm will join the engine line-up of the new SEAT Leon. It will return fuel consumption figures of 5.2 litres per 100 kilometres and a CO2 figure of 119 grams per kilometre. The pinnacle of the TSI engine range will be a 1.8 producing 180PS and 250Nm. This engine will join the line-up later in 2013.

Chassis - performance with comfort

The running gear of the new SEAT Leon has a sporty and agile character. The suspension smoothes out all manner of surface defects, while the steering conveys refined, calm directionality with a fine degree of feedback.

The new SEAT Leon uses an all-new vehicle architecture that has been developed from scratch. Its engines are all angled at 12 degrees to the rear. This and the compact engine layout enabled engineers to move the front axle forward by 40 millimetres. The results are a longer wheelbase and a well-balanced distribution of axle load - factors that have a major impact on the comfort and sporty handling of the new SEAT Leon.

At the front are MacPherson struts on a subframe. The compact five-door responds quickly and precisely to steering input, mastering all manner of bends and corners with relaxed stability. The ratio of the new speed-sensitive electromechanical power steering is sporty and direct. It makes a significant contribution to the efficiency of the new Leon because it consumes no energy during straight-line driving. The turning circle measures just 10.2 metres.

On engine versions up to 110 kW (150 PS), the rear of the new SEAT Leon is equipped with a twist-beam axle suspension. The more powerful variants use a multi-link set-up that handles longitudinal and transverse forces independently from one another. Shock absorbers and coil springs are mounted separately to deliver a particularly refined response. An electronic transverse differential lock applies tiny braking impulses to the lighter inside front wheel to make handling at the cornering limits safer and even more fluid. The ESP electronic stability program has been perfectly adapted, while the braking system on the new SEAT Leon is also a match for even the toughest conditions.

The SEAT Drive Profile

The character of the new Leon FR can be individualised to suit both mood and situation: The SEAT Drive Profile enables the driver to vary the characteristics of the power steering, engine response and DSG transmission in three modes - eco, comfort and sport, plus an additional individual setting. The SEAT Drive Profile in the Leon FR will also influence the engine sound (1.8 TSI 180PS and 2.0 TDI 184PS engines only), which is modulated via a sound actuator, as well as the interior ambient lighting - depending on driving style, the door-mounted LEDs switch between white (comfort, eco and individual) and red (sport).

The full-LED headlamps

The SEAT Leon makes innovative, full-LED headlights available in the compact class for the very first time. Alongside their distinctive design, LED headlamps have numerous other benefits. For example, they illuminate the road ahead with a colour temperature of 5,500 Kelvin. Because this is very close to daylight, it is extremely gentle on the eyes. And, when it comes to efficiency, the LEDs emit their light with minimal energy consumption - dipped beam, for instance, consumes just 20 watts per unit.

The distinctive contour of the positioning and daytime running lights on the new SEAT Leon is created by two white LEDs per unit, their light channelled to create the distinctive light signature. Nine yellow LEDs on each side create the indicator lights, which are also integrated into the headlamps units. Each dipped beam is made up of six modules. When full beam is switched on, an additional three powerful spot modules are activated on each side, while the dipped beam is raised to match. Intelligent sensors ensure that oncoming traffic is not dazzled. In addition to all this, the new full-LED headlamps are completely maintenance free and designed to last the lifetime of the vehicle.

Within the functionality of the full-LEDs, the angle of the beam is raised when the car has been travelling above 110km/h for more than 30 seconds, giving improved visibility over a longer distance, but without disturbing the view of oncoming traffic.

SEAT Easy Connect - modern and flexible

SEAT is offering a wide selection of state-of-the-art infotainment solutions in the new Leon. The foundation for this is the SEAT Easy Connect operating system, which enables the control of entertainment and communication functions, in addition to numerous vehicle functions, via a cockpit touchscreen. Measuring up to 5.8 inches, the touchscreen and its associated buttons and rotary controls are located centrally in a convenient position between the central air vents. It is easy to read and to reach for both driver and front seat passenger.

For the first time, SEAT is using a touch-sensitive screen with proximity sensor (5.8-inch screen). As soon as the driver's or passenger's finger approaches the touchscreen, the system automatically switches from display to operating mode. In operating mode, the elements that can be activated via the touchscreen are brought to the fore, making intuitive use (smartphone-style swipe and zoom gestures) even easier. The display mode, on the other hand, is distinguished by its extremely clear and uncluttered presentation. The graphics of both modes are a perfect match for the sporty aesthetic of the SEAT design.

Media System Touch (5-inch): The entry level is the Media System Touch with a 5-inch touchscreen, radio with SD-card slot and four speakers. External devices for playing individual playlists can be connected via USB or aux-in points. Arranged evenly on the left and right of the touchscreen are six buttons that activate the functions "Radio", "Media", "Car", "Setup", "Sound" and "Mute". The Media System Touch is standard equipment with the Reference equipment line.

Media System Colour (5-inch): In the Style and FR, the Media System Colour with SD Card reader and CD drive (MP3 capable) and six speakers is part of the standard equipment. It connects to external devices via Bluetooth, USB or aux-in. Its colour, 5-inch touchscreen also serves to control vehicle functions.

Media System Plus (5.8-inch): The Media System Plus comes with a 5.8-inch touchscreen with three-dimensional graphics, as well as an optional DAB tuner for digital radio reception and voice control. The system delivers sound to six or eight speakers. Evenly arranged to the left and right of the touchscreen are eight buttons. In addition to those provided with the 5-inch systems and depending on equipment, they provide access to the functions "Phone" and "Voice". The SD card, USB and iPod connector can be found in the glovebox, while the screen provides high definition and a large palette of colours.

Navi System (5.8-inch): The top solution is the same as Media System Plus, but also incorporates a voice activitated navigation system. Route guidance information is also displayed on the colour screen between the speedometer and rev counter, directly in the driver's line of sight.

The Driver Assistance Systems - groundbreaking

The designers of the new SEAT Leon successfully achieved a notable increase in comfort and safety despite the reduction in kerb weight of up to 90 kilograms, with a portfolio of groundbreaking driver assistance systems.

Drowsiness detection: The system analyses the driver's characteristic steering input and continuously evaluates permanent signals like steering angle or steering speed. The drowsiness detection system registers when the driver's concentration is failing and emits an acoustic warning signal supplemented by a display symbol that recommends taking a break. Should the driver elect not to take a break within the subsequent 15 minutes, the warning is repeated. Independently of this, the activated system advises the driver to take a break after four hours of uninterrupted driving.

Full Beam Assist: A camera system integrated into the base of the rear view mirror controls the Full Beam Assist (upwards of 60 km/h), switching automatically between full and dipped beam. It identifies oncoming traffic and vehicles driving in front, as well as illuminated residential areas, thus ensuring that other road users are not dazzled.

Lane-keeping assistant (Heading Control): The camera-based lane-keeping assistant Heading Control makes slight adjustments to the electromechanical steering before the driver deviates from course and crosses a lane marking.

The Equipment - stylish and individual

The new SEAT Leon will be available for sale on the European market in 2012 - with highly competitive pricing and extensive equipment. The four equipment lines on offer are Leon, Reference, Style and FR.

Furthermore, the new SEAT Leon also comes with a wide range of safety, comfort and sport options. They include full-LED headlamps, front seat arm rests, electric sun roof, automatically dimming rear view mirror, light and rain sensor, the SEAT sound system and the navigation system to name but a few.

Leon

Seven airbags are part of the standard equipment package on all versions of the SEAT Leon. In addition to that are power windows up front, an on-board computer with external temperature display, remote central locking, a height-adjustable driver's seat and Isofix and Top-Tether anchor points in the rear for child seats. The grille is framed in chrome, while the door handles and wing mirrors are painted in body colour. The entry-level Leon stands on 15-inch wheels.

Leon Reference

The Leon Reference comes with several extra comfort features. The extensive standard equipment is complemented by an air conditioning system with manual controls, the Media System Touch and the rear bench back rest with a 60:40 split.

Leon Style

The Leon Style offers compelling value for money. It comes with 16-inch alloy wheels, cruise control, the Media System Colour with six speakers and mobile phone connection via Bluetooth. The multi-function steering wheel is clad in leather and the wing mirrors are heated. The centre console incorporates an arm rest with storage bin, as well as a separate air vent for rear-seat passengers. In terms of interior trims, there are three options: black, black and grey or beige, as well as a choice of three leather trims: black, black and grey or beige, plus an Alcantara trim.

Leon FR

Sporty SEAT variants traditionally bear the FR badge. The Leon FR is recognisable through its 17-inch alloy wheels, fog lamps, cornering lights, sporty bumpers, FR suspension, tinted rear windows, folding wing mirrors and LED rear lights. Inside, it offers aluminium entry sills, a leather-clad sports steering wheel, sports seats with lumbar support, ambient lighting, Climatronic and power windows in the rear. Using the SEAT Drive Profile, the driver can adapt the vehicle settings to suit the driving conditions. The fine sound of the Media System Colour is delivered through eight speakers and the interior trim options consist of black leather or Alcantara.
